ZKX's LAB

请问在C++里面怎样才能在控制台的指定坐标输出字符? 坐标控制台

2020-08-11知识22

C语言控制台输出指定位置 1.gotoxy函数:原型:extern void gotoxy(int x,int y);用法:#include功能:将光标移动到指定位置说明:gotoxy(x,y)将光标移动到指定行y和列x。设置光标到文本屏幕的指定位置,其中参数x,y为文本屏幕的坐标。gotoxy(0,0)将光标移动到屏幕左上角2.例程(下面这个例子将在屏幕中央输出“hello world”):12345678#include<;conio.h>;int main(){ clrscr();清除屏幕 gotoxy(35,12);挪动鼠标到屏幕中央 cputs(\"Hello world\");getch();return 0;}C语言控制台程序中如何获取光标位置?就是(x, y)坐标。 结果:DeskTopPos:X:680 Y:592ClientPos:X:586 Y:444请按任意键继续.代码:includeinclude\"stdlib.hincludemain(){HWND hConsole=FindWindow(\"ConsoleWindowClass\",NULL);POINT pt;GetCursorPos(&pt);printf(\"DeskTopPos:\\nX:%4i Y:%4i\\n\",pt.x,pt.y);ScreenToClient(hConsole,&pt);printf(\"ClientPos:\\nX:%4i Y:%4i\\n\",pt.x,pt.y);fflush(stdin);system(\"pause\");}函数连接:http://baike.baidu.com/view/1080506.htmhttp://baike.baidu.com/view/1079910.htm楼主好运!美丽水世界怎么开控制台使用代码,美丽水世界怎么开控制台使用代码?游戏中进入死循环了,或者海虾号在深海中没电了点点,身上东西多不舍得掉,这个时候我们就可以使用控制。请问在C++里面怎样才能在控制台的指定坐标输出字符? window有具体api函数来操作这些控制台输出输入缓冲区。可以在指定的位置进行输出,还可以设置字符的颜色等。在《intel汇编语言程序设计》这本书里看见过,从外国翻译过来的,罗云彬 申校。三、控制台窗口操作用于控制台窗口操作的API函数如下:GetConsoleScreenBufferInfo 获取控制台窗口信息GetConsoleTitle 获取控制台窗口标题ScrollConsoleScreenBuffer 在缓冲区中移动数据块SetConsoleScreenBufferSize 更改指定缓冲区大小SetConsoleTitle 设置控制台窗口标题SetConsoleWindowInfo 设置控制台窗口信息此外,还有窗口字体、显示模式等控制函数,这里不再细说。下列举一个示例,程序如下:includeincludeincludevoid main(){HANDLE hOut=GetStdHandle(STD_OUTPUT_HANDLE);获取标准输出设备句柄CONSOLE_SCREEN_BUFFER_INFO bInfo;窗口缓冲区信息GetConsoleScreenBufferInfo(hOut,bInfo);获取窗口缓冲区信息char strTitle[255];GetConsoleTitle(strTitle,255);获取窗口标题printf(\"当前窗口标题是:%s\\n\",strTitle);getch();SetConsoleTitle(\"控制台窗口操作\");获取窗口标题getch();COORD size={80,25};SetConsoleScreenBufferSize(hOut,size);。如何用c++/c在控制台绘制坐标 控制台绘制坐标没啥意义。C语言绘制坐标很多都是在操作系统C语言显示器部分。(调用汇编函数当然汇编部分肯定是要调用BIOS的C语言控制台中怎么能获取光标当前的坐标值呢? 1、:GetCursorPos会获取当前鼠标所在的点,参数为POINT结构变量的地址。2、如下面的例子:includeincludevoid main(){POINT point;GetCursorPos(&point);printf(\"x=d,y=d\\n\",point.x,point.y);}GetCursorPos(&point);将获得的位置放入point变量中,通过point.x和point.y可以得知位置怎样在VC++下在控制台程序窗口指定坐标位置输入内容 include<;stdio.h>;#include<;stdlib.h>;#include<;windows.h>;int main(){/获取控制台句柄 HANDLE hConsole=GetStdHandle(STD_OUTPUT_HANDLE);鼠标光标的坐标 COORD cursorPos={。C语言控制台中怎么能获取光标当前的坐标值呢? ccp文件#include<;stdio.h>;#include<;stdlib.h>;#include<;windows.h>;int main(){while(1){POINT point;GetCursorPos(&point);printf(\"x=d,y=d\\n\",point.x,point.y);system(。[控制台(8)] 设置控制台输出的光标位置[TZZ] [控制台(8)]设置控制台输出的光标位置[TZZ],大家好!今天我给大家介绍一下“在Widow控制台中,通过程序设置标准输出缓存下次输出位置(即光标位置)的方法”。。C语言怎么设置控制台窗口出现的位置? 就是控制台黑窗口,用devc+或者cfree编写,能够实现吗?求大神!原问题:C语言怎么设置窗口出现的位置啊…

#c语言#控制台#控制台程序#include

随机阅读

qrcode
访问手机版